    City shrugs off Cigna's move

    07/13/11 City officials breathed a sigh of relief Tuesday. Cigna Corp., one of the nation's largest insurers, whose history in Philadelphia dates back to 1792, isn't packing up and moving its entire workforce from Philadelphia to Connecticut. It is retaining 1,100 jobs and using multiple floors of office space at Two Liberty Plaza in Center City.
